Training Frequency: How Often Should You Train Each Muscle Group Per Week?

· Chris · 4 min read

“How often per week should I train chest?” Most lifters ask this at some point. The short answer: at least 2×. The longer answer explains why frequency matters less than you think — and why it still determines your split.

2× Per Week Beats 1×

Training each muscle group at least 2× per week (instead of just 1×) produces noticeably more growth — at equal total volume. The difference isn’t marginal: it’s one of the clearest findings in exercise science. More than 2× shows no clear additional benefit.

Why 2× Is Better

After training, your muscle is in growth mode for roughly 24-48 hours. Then the signal fades — no matter how much you did.

If you only train chest on Monday, you’re building Monday through Wednesday. Thursday through Sunday: nothing. Train chest Monday and Thursday, and you get two growth windows instead of one.

At equal total volume (e.g., 16 sets per week), 2× frequency means 8 sets per session instead of 16. That gives you:

  • Less fatigue per session → higher quality per set
  • Two growth windows instead of one
  • Shorter sessions → more manageable

Frequency vs. Volume: What Matters More?

Volume matters more than frequency.

More sets per week = more growth (up to your individual ceiling). That’s well established. Frequency is a tool to distribute volume effectively.

If you want to do 16 sets of chest per week, 2× 8 is better than 1× 16 — not because 2× is magic, but because set quality is higher in shorter sessions.

Takeaway: Frequency follows volume, not the other way around. First determine how much volume you need (How Many Sets Per Muscle Group?), then distribute it across your training days.

Note: Compound exercises train multiple muscles simultaneously. If you bench 2× and overhead press 2×, you’re already hitting triceps 4× — without extra isolation.

How Frequency Determines Your Split

Your split isn’t a free choice — it follows logically from your available frequency.

2-3 Days Per Week → Full Body

At 3 training days, full body is the only split that gives every muscle group 2× frequency. An upper/lower split at 3 days would mean: U-L-U one week, L-U-L the next. Works, but uneven.

4 Days Per Week → Upper/Lower

U-L-U-L gives you exactly 2× frequency for everything. The most efficient distribution at 4 days.

5-6 Days Per Week → Push/Pull/Legs

PPL-PPL gives you 2× frequency at 6 days. At 5 days, you rotate: PPL-PP one week, L-PPL the next.

Beginners vs. Advanced

Beginners (0-12 months): 2× per week per muscle group is enough. Beginners need less volume (8-10 sets/week) — that fits easily into 2 sessions.

Intermediate (1-3 years): 2× remains the minimum. 3× can make sense if you need to fit in high volume (16+ sets) without overloading each session.

Advanced (3+ years): Individual. Some muscle groups benefit from 3-4× (shoulders, arms, calves), others stay at 2× (quads, which wreck your whole body).

Bottom Line

Training frequency is less complicated than the social media debate suggests: at least 2× per week per muscle group. More can help, but doesn’t have to. Volume is the stronger lever.

Frequency determines your split, not the other way around. Choose the training days that fit your life and distribute your volume evenly. That’s the whole trick.
